PureTech Health plc announced that Raju Kucherlapati, PhD, has been appointed Chair of the Board of Directors, effective immediately, following his role as interim Chair since June 2023. Dr. Kucherlapati has served as a member of PureTech?s Board of Directors since 2014. He is currently Chair of the Board?s Nomination Committee and sits on the Audit and Remuneration Committees.

Dr. Kucherlapati will continue his current Board committee responsibilities until a replacement is identified at an appropriate time. Dr. Kucherlapati is the Paul C. Cabot Professor of Genetics and Professor of Medicine at Harvard Medical School and currently serves on the Board of Directors of KEW Inc. He was a founder and formerly a board member of Abgenix (acquired by Amgen for $2.2 billion), Cell Genesys and Millennium Pharmaceuticals (acquired by Takeda for $8.8 billion). He was the first scientific director of the Harvard-Partners Center for Genetics and Genomics. He is a fellow of the American Association for the Advancement of Science and a member of the National Academy of Medicine.

Dr. Kucherlapati received his PhD from the University of Illinois. He trained at Yale and has held faculty positions at Princeton University, University of Illinois College of Medicine and the Albert Einstein College of Medicine. He was a member of the presidential commission for the study of bioethical issues during the Obama administration.
